MONTGOMERY VILLAGE, Md. — A new Burlington store is coming soon to the Montgomery Village Center, taking over the space previously occupied by Big Lots, which closed in March 2025. The change marks another shift in the evolving retail landscape of upper Montgomery County.
“Coming Soon” Signs Confirm Burlington’s Arrival
New signage announcing Burlington’s arrival has been installed at 19142 Montgomery Village Avenue, generating buzz among residents and shoppers in the area. The store will serve as a new anchor within the Montgomery Village Center, a longtime community shopping hub.
Though no official opening date has been announced, the “Coming Soon” signs signal that build-out is likely underway. The property had been vacant since Big Lots permanently closed earlier this year.
About Burlington: A Growing National Retailer
Burlington, formerly known as Burlington Coat Factory, is a national off-price retailer that offers discounted brand-name merchandise for men, women, and children. Its inventory typically includes clothing, shoes, accessories, beauty products, and home goods.
With over 1,000 stores nationwide, Burlington has expanded significantly in recent years, often moving into spaces vacated by other retailers. The company’s value-focused model has made it popular among budget-conscious shoppers seeking brand-name products at a lower cost.
The new Montgomery Village location will be Burlington’s fourth store in Montgomery County, joining:
-
Gaithersburg at 600 N Frederick Avenue
-
Rockville at 12089 Rockville Pike
-
Silver Spring at 8661 Colesville Road
Big Lots Closure Leaves Gap in Germantown
While Montgomery Village’s Big Lots is being replaced by Burlington, no replacement has yet been announced for the Big Lots in Germantown, located at 20926 Frederick Road, which also closed earlier this year.
The closure of both locations came amid a broader national downsizing by Big Lots, which has been shedding underperforming stores in various markets. The fate of the Germantown location remains unclear, and local residents are waiting to see what might take its place.
What This Means for the Community
The addition of Burlington to Montgomery Village Center could help revitalize foot traffic in the shopping plaza, which has seen fluctuations in tenant occupancy in recent years. With a focus on affordable goods and frequent inventory updates, Burlington may appeal to a wide range of shoppers, from families to local professionals.
Residents are hopeful the new store will open in time for back-to-school season or holiday shopping, though Burlington has yet to confirm a launch timeline.
